FAQ for Camber and Alignment Kit Repair

Q: What is the adjustment procedure for the Rear Toe?
A:
Loosen the adjuster nut. Using a wrench to rotate the adjuster bolt, adjust the cam to specifications. Using a wrench to hold the adjuster bolt, tighten the adjuster nut. Check the toe alignment and adjust if required. Test drive the vehicle.

Q: What is the recommended torque for the adjuster nut?
A:
The recommended torque is 140 Nm (103 lb-ft).

Q: What is the recommended torque for the tie rod end jam nuts?
A:
The recommended torque is 68 Nm (50 lb-ft).

Q: What is the recommended torque for the strut lower nuts?
A:
The recommended torque is 195 Nm (144 lb-ft).

Q: How do you measure the front and rear alignment angles?
A:
Install the alignment equipment according to the manufacturer's instructions. Jounce the front and the rear bumpers 3 times before checking the wheel alignment. Measure the alignment angles and record the readings. Adjust alignment angles to vehicle specification, if necessary.
